We're seeking a skilled Assistant Design Manager to join our Construction team at Kier Group, working on a high-profile project at a secure facility.

**Key Responsibilities:**

• Support the Head of Design in managing and delivering design solutions through all RIBA stages.

• Assist in producing design programmes, design scopes, design responsibility matrices, appointments, schedules to record progress, and upline reporting.

• Participate in necessary meetings and workshops, and take ownership of reviewing design documentation for contract compliance.

• Collaborate with the team to develop and implement design solutions, ensuring timely and within-budget delivery.

• Support the production of Scope of Works and works packages, and contribute to the technical evaluation during the tender phase.
